Russia attacks kyiv with ballistic missiles. Ukraine says it intercepted them all

2023-12-11 08:12:02

kyiv, Ukraine (AP) — Russia launched eight ballistic missiles at kyiv that were shot down Monday morning, according to the Ukrainian air force. The attack left one injured by shrapnel and three other people suffered strong stress reactions, according to authorities.

Several loud explosions rang out in the Ukrainian capital following 4 a.m., when the city was under a nighttime curfew. Then the air raid sirens sounded.

Interior Minister Ihor Kylmenko said that in the Darnytskyi district of eastern kyiv, the remains of an intercepted missile fell without catching fire, and elsewhere in the capital the shock wave broke the windows of a house.

kyiv is often attacked by Russian drones and missiles.

Just two weeks ago, the capital suffered what Ukrainian authorities described as the most intense drone attack since the full-scale Russian invasion began in 2022. According to the Ukrainian air force, Russia used 75 Iranian-made Shahed drones once morest the capital , of which 74 were destroyed by anti-aircraft defenses.

Elsewhere in Ukraine, 18 Russian drone attacks were reported and intercepted, mostly in the southern region of Mykolaiv.
